Video: Common Visits The Morning Riot

Posted on April 13, 2012 by Andrew Barber

Com Sense dropped by WGCI’s Tony Sco and The Morning Riot this morning.  He discusses the forthcoming film Something To Nothing and sends a message to the youth of Chicago about the surging violence.

Also, those attending today’s White Sox home opener, will find Com on the mound tossing out the first pitch.
